Baghdad, Undersecretary of the Ministry of Planning for Technical Affairs Maher Hammad Johan discussed with the First Assistant to the Head of the USAID Mission in Iraq, Andrew Pelt, strengthening cooperation in various fields.

The Ministry stated in a statement: “The meeting discussed strengthening joint cooperation in various fields between the Iraqi government and the United States Agency for International Development (USAID), within the scope of the government’s priorities specified in its government program, and the five-year national development plan for the years (2024-2028), in addition to discussing aspects of future cooperation related to climate change, the investment environment in Iraq and raising levels of economic growth.”

The Undersecretary explained: “The government is currently focusing on a number of priorities, including confronting climate change, adopting renewable energy, and focusing on creating an attractive environment for investment.”

He stressed the importance of raising the lev
el of cooperation and coordinating meetings at the technical level between the Ministry’s team and the US Agency for International Development, to achieve maximum benefit from international support.

The meeting was attended by Erin Moon Marquis and Deputy US Ambassador to Iraq David Borker, in addition to the Director General of International Cooperation Saher Abdul Kadhim, and a number of stakeholders in the Ministry.
